Posting Guidelines

We created this thread as a centralized location for all political threads. While we welcome spirited debate and opinions I feel obligated to remind everyone of the ORG's Code of Conduct. The Staff will be enforcing these rules.

General Guidelines

Posting derogatory comments of a racial, religious, or sexual nature are forbidden. This includes your username, signature line, and title. Site Staff reserves the right to edit these items and to remove your ability to modify them in the future.

Posting pictures or links to images which contain pornography, nudity, animal cruelty, racism, or sexism is not allowed and may result in an instant ban.

Posting of someone else's personal contact information is not allowed.
Attacking or insulting a person in an effort to elicit a negative response is forbidden. You have a right to disagree, but please do so in a respectful manner.

No posting topics or discussions that do the site or community harm. More specifically creating topics meant to disrupt the site's day to day management, disrupt member's resources, or disrupt the ability for the site to function normally.

Companies or individuals cannot advertise or sell products and or services in the forums (including siglines and titles) without prior approval from the site Administrators.

Fraudulent practices or attempts to defraud another person or group will be dealt with very seriously.

Situations which have not been covered in this code of conduct that may arise will be handled by Moderator and Admin Staff who have been carefully chosen to treat such issues with fairness.
